Dawgs on the road; Virginia Tech holds spring game Gene Marrano April 13, 2018 1 min read The Roanoke Rail Yard Dawgs have their back to the wall against Peoria tonight on the road and Tech holds its spring football game. Share: Post navigation Previous: Has the bald eagle population along the James River peaked?Next: Kaine unsure if he’ll vote for Secretary of State nominee Related Stories 1 min read Batman actor Michael Keaton endorses 6th District Congressional candidate Beth Macy Clark Palmer November 20, 2025 0 1 min read Are you interested in an RSO inclusive adult ensemble? Denise Membreno November 20, 2025 0 1 min read Healing Strides of Virginia continues to tweak its programs serving veterans often in crisis Gene Marrano November 20, 2025 0